Oct 19, 2015 in spqr, an instant classic, mary beard narrates the history of rome with passion and without technical jargon and demonstrates how a slightly shabby iron age village rose to become the undisputed hegemon of the mediterranean wall street journal. The book covers roman history from its semimythical origins in roughly 753 bc to the decision by emperor caracalla in 212 ce to make all free adult males born within the empire roman citizens.
